Key Responsibilities:
- Oversee daily treasury operations, cash flow management, and bank mandates
- Manage liquidity, funding, and energy-related financial transactions
- Support treasury systems, banking platforms, and process improvements
- Ensure compliance with KYC, regulatory reporting, and internal controls
- Assist with debt, derivatives, and financial risk management
